Currently, LAPD partners with LAHSA Emergency Response Teams (ERT) to identify and target high utilizers of emergency services on Skid Row, often chronically homeless individuals. The Emergency Response Program (ERP) provides low-barrier, safe, and supportive 24 hours emergency shelter services when it is activated as a result of severe weather or circumstances that pose an immediate danger to unsheltered individuals.
